Patients with cognitive impairment may experience greater improvements in cognition with trans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R) than with surgical aortic valve replacement (SAVR), new research suggests.
Investigators analyzed data from the PARTNER 3 (Safety and Effectiveness of the SAPIEN 3 Transcatheter Heart Valve in Low-Risk Patients with Aortic Stenosis) trial of 1000 patients with severe aortic stenosis, who were randomized to receive either TAVR or SAVR.
